Fluoride
Fluoride can help improve the health of your mouth and to prevent cavities. Fluoride is present in the soil, water, and foods. It can be added to toothpaste or water sources for a variety of different reasons.

The primary function of this material is to prevent tooth decay. It achieves this through “remineralizing”, bonding enamel to areas damaged, then drawing stronger minerals like calcium. This process creates a new, harder, stronger enamel, called fluorapatite. It’s also stronger and more immune to acids and bacteria.

This is why the American Dental Association recommends brushing with fluoride toothpaste at least twice a every day. Your dentist could recommend gels and varnishes with fluoride to provide additional security.

There are numerous options of toothpastes with fluoride. The majority of commercial brands contain at least 1000 parts per million fluoride. 0.221% sodium fluoride or 0.76% sodium monofluorophosphate).

It is recommended that the American Academy of Pediatrics recommends that kids use a toothpaste that contains at minimum 1000ppm fluoride. The toothpaste should be used as a “smear” on a small toothbrush to minimize the risk of swallowing. Additionally, it should be angled slightly downward so that excess paste dribbles from the mouth, not through the throat.

Peppermint
In the current season, peppermint is the most well-known flavor and toothpaste has been making use of it for a long time. The unique flavor and breath-freshening properties of the plant make it an ideal toothpaste flavor.

The peppermint’s menthol can be responsible for the cooling, refreshing sensation it provides. Menthol is also an antibacterial agent which helps to fight off harmful bacteria . It also helps reduce bad breath.

Along with its breath-freshening effects, menthol can also stimulate the sense receptors within the mouth as well as on your skin. This can cause cool effects. It’s a good idea to make use of peppermint toothpaste when you want to maintain good gums and teeth, because it may help prevent cavities by strengthening enamel.

According to Bob Vogt, senior flavorist at Colgate the majority of people like peppermint’s “slightly sweetness” and “lingering coolness” that peppermint offers. Peppermint is a great way to mask off flavors from other components.
